Output 538c76fce28ab7d8efd329505d8f63834115ac025573ac0d27aecae842208436:6

value
9441586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66baeee9ecb46efb7c4d3493dbb416d6ea11347 OP_EQUAL
address
3MEmXZgZFbV89N8hX9XAHXwQ6EvktyceyQ
transaction
538c76fce28ab7d8efd329505d8f63834115ac025573ac0d27aecae842208436
spent
true